-
-
Notifications
You must be signed in to change notification settings - Fork 1
chore(deps): update renovatebot/github-action action to v44.2.6 #371
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
base: master
Are you sure you want to change the base?
Conversation
|
The latest updates on your projects. Learn more about Vercel for GitHub.
|
|
Note Gemini is unable to generate a summary for this pull request due to the file types involved not being currently supported. |
📝 WalkthroughWalkthroughThe Renovate GitHub Action version was changed from Changes
Estimated code review effort🎯 1 (Trivial) | ⏱️ ~2 minutes 🚥 Pre-merge checks | ✅ 3✅ Passed checks (3 passed)
✏️ Tip: You can configure your own custom pre-merge checks in the settings. ✨ Finishing touches
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out. Comment |
9bea326 to
5bd5c97
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Actionable comments posted: 1
🤖 Fix all issues with AI agents
In @.github/workflows/renovate.yml:
- Line 40: The workflow references a non-existent action tag uses:
renovatebot/[email protected]; update that reference to a valid tag (e.g.,
renovatebot/[email protected]) or replace it with a pinned commit SHA for
supply-chain hardening, and ensure the change is made where the uses entry for
renovatebot/github-action appears in the workflow file.
📜 Review details
Configuration used: Organization UI
Review profile: ASSERTIVE
Plan: Pro
📒 Files selected for processing (1)
.github/workflows/renovate.yml
🧰 Additional context used
📓 Path-based instructions (1)
.github/workflows/*.{yml,yaml}
📄 CodeRabbit inference engine (.github/copilot-instructions.md)
Configure GitHub Actions CI/CD pipelines in
.github/workflows/for automated testing, linting, and deployment.
Files:
.github/workflows/renovate.yml
✏️ Tip: You can disable this entire section by setting review_details to false in your review settings.
.github/workflows/renovate.yml
Outdated
| # https://github.com/renovatebot/github-action | ||
| - name: Renovate | ||
| uses: renovatebot/[email protected].3 | ||
| uses: renovatebot/[email protected].4 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
🧩 Analysis chain
🌐 Web query:
renovatebot/github-action v44.2.4 release notes latest version
💡 Result:
I couldn't find a release tagged v44.2.4 for renovatebot/github-action. The repository's Releases page shows v44.0.3 (published Nov 17, 2025) as the latest release. [1][2]
Sources:
- renovatebot/github-action — Releases (latest: v44.0.3, 2025-11-17). [1]
- renovatebot/github-action — README (references current action tags). [2]
🌐 Web query:
GitHub Actions SHA pinning best practices supply chain security
💡 Result:
Short best-practices checklist for SHA-pinning GitHub Actions (supply‑chain security), with sources:
- Pin third‑party actions to a full commit SHA (owner/repo@{full-commit-sha}) — this is the only way to make an action immutable. [1][2]
- Enforce SHA‑pinning organization/enterprise‑wide using GitHub’s Allowed Actions policy so unpinned uses fail CI. [3][2]
- Verify the SHA originates from the action’s official repo (not a fork) and record the human‑readable version (tag) in a comment for maintainability (e.g., # v1.2.3). [1][2]
- Prefer first‑party or well‑maintained actions; audit action source code (and any external downloads) before pinning. Avoid “unpinnable” actions that fetch unsigned remote code or run dynamic installers. [1][4]
- Treat local actions differently: either exclude local actions from pinning enforcement or move them to a separate repo and reference them by repo/path@SHA to comply. [5][3]
- Automate pin maintenance: use Dependabot or tooling (e.g., pinsha or scripts) to detect updates and open PRs that update the SHA after review. [2][3]
- Combine pinning with least‑privilege workflow permissions, secrets protection (avoid exposing secrets to third‑party PRs), and monitoring/alerting for changes to used actions. Pinning is necessary but not sufficient. [1][4][3]
If you want, I can:
- scan a repo’s workflows and produce a PR-friendly list of unpinned actions and suggested SHAs, or
- provide example workflow snippets and Dependabot configuration for automated, reviewed updates.
🏁 Script executed:
cat -n .github/workflows/renovate.yml | sed -n '38,42p'Repository: WomB0ComB0/portfolio
Length of output: 261
Update renovatebot/github-action to v44.0.3; v44.2.4 does not exist.
The version v44.2.4 is not available in the renovatebot/github-action repository (latest is v44.0.3). This will cause the workflow to fail. Update to v44.0.3 or verify the intended version. Additionally, consider pinning to a commit SHA for supply-chain hardening once the correct version is confirmed.
🤖 Prompt for AI Agents
In @.github/workflows/renovate.yml at line 40, The workflow references a
non-existent action tag uses: renovatebot/[email protected]; update that
reference to a valid tag (e.g., renovatebot/[email protected]) or replace it
with a pinned commit SHA for supply-chain hardening, and ensure the change is
made where the uses entry for renovatebot/github-action appears in the workflow
file.
5bd5c97 to
185c9a1
Compare
185c9a1 to
d440e4b
Compare
d440e4b to
80841a3
Compare
This PR contains the following updates:
v44.2.3→v44.2.6Release Notes
renovatebot/github-action (renovatebot/github-action)
v44.2.6Compare Source
Documentation
Miscellaneous Chores
Build System
Continuous Integration
v44.2.5Compare Source
Documentation
Miscellaneous Chores
Build System
Continuous Integration
v44.2.4Compare Source
Documentation
Miscellaneous Chores
Build System
Continuous Integration
Configuration
📅 Schedule: Branch creation - At any time (no schedule defined), Automerge - At any time (no schedule defined).
🚦 Automerge: Enabled.
♻ Rebasing: Whenever PR is behind base branch, or you tick the rebase/retry checkbox.
🔕 Ignore: Close this PR and you won't be reminded about this update again.
This PR has been generated by Renovate Bot.